ASTM A694 F46
ASTM A694 F46 Flanges & Fittings
ASTM A694 Grade F46 is a high-strength carbon steel forging material engineered for use in high-pressure transmission systems. This grade is widely used in oil & gas pipelines, petrochemical industries, cross-country transmission lines, and offshore platforms where superior strength, toughness, and reliability are essential.
F46 is part of the A694 standard which includes forged carbon steel flanges, fittings, valves, and components designed to handle extreme pressure and demanding operating conditions. With enhanced mechanical strength and excellent impact resistance, ASTM A694 F46 is the preferred material for pipeline flanges and critical pressure vessel components.

Chemical Composition
| Element | % (Max/Range) |
|---|---|
| Carbon (C) | 0.30 Max |
| Manganese (Mn) | 0.60 – 1.35 |
| Phosphorus (P) | 0.025 Max |
| Sulfur (S) | 0.025 Max |
| Silicon (Si) | 0.15 – 0.40 |
| Vanadium (V) | 0.08 Max |
| Niobium (Nb) | 0.05 Max |
| Titanium (Ti) | 0.04 Max |
Mechanical Properties
| Property | Value |
|---|---|
| Tensile Strength | 485 MPa Min |
| Yield Strength | 320 MPa Min |
| Elongation | 22% Min |
| Hardness | 197 HB Max |
| Impact Test | Required for pipeline service |

Heat Treatment
Normalizing
Quenching & Tempering
Stress Relieving (if required)
Heat treatment enhances toughness and grain refinement.
Welding
Good weldability with standard procedures
Pre-heating recommended for thicker sections
PWHT suggested depending on weld thickness & service condition
Low-hydrogen electrodes recommended
